Exploring GST Reconciliation Software Features

Effective GST reconciliation software is designed to manage big volumes of data, matching invoices with the corresponding entries in the GST portal. This coordinating procedure is important for claiming input tax credits (ITC) accurately. Here are the key functions to search for in an ideal GST reconciliation software:

1. Automated Data Matching: The software should instantly compare invoices uploaded by the provider versus those received and taped in the buyer's records. This feature reduces the requirement for manual data entry, reducing errors and making sure precision in the reconciliation process.

2. Real-Time Data Synchronization: With real-time data updates, organizations can guarantee that their records are always in sync with the GST portal. This is vital for satisfying filing deadlines and preventing penalties due to inconsistencies.

3. Comprehensive Reporting Capabilities: Detailed reports are essential for examining the GST data efficiently. The software should have the ability to generate numerous reports such as mismatch reports, ITC eligibility reports, and compliance reports, which are invaluable for auditing and compliance functions.

4. HSN Bulk Verification: A robust GST software will include tools for Harmonized System of Nomenclature (HSN) code confirmation, which is crucial for categorizing goods and services properly under GST. This feature help companies in making sure that their products are classified properly, avoiding possible tax problems.

GST Input Tax Credit & Its Calculation

The concept of GST input tax credit is central to the GST system, enabling businesses to minimize their tax liability by claiming credit for the tax paid on inputs. Reliable GST reconciliation software simplifies the estimation of GST ITC by ensuring that all qualified credits are accurately accounted for. It carries out a detailed contrast of GSTR-2A and GSTR-2B documents to determine any discrepancies in the tax credits declared, aiding services in maximizing their ITC benefits while sticking to the legal framework.

GSTR 2A and 2B Reconciliation

Reconciliation of GSTR 2A and 2B is a compulsory process for services to ensure that the input tax credit declared matches the tax information filed by the providers. This process assists in recognizing mismatches, disqualified credits, and potential fraud. A competent GST reconciliation tool automates this procedure, saving time and minimizing the burden of manual reconciliations. It also assists in preparing accurate income tax return, therefore decreasing the possibility of audits and penalties from tax authorities.
